Starmer's Government Adjustments

Keir Starmer appointed Minouche Shafik as chief economic adviser in 2024.
Shafik resigned from Columbia University in August 2024 after backlash over Palestine protests.
Darren Jones became chief secretary to address growth and immigration issues.
Dave Pares praised Shafik's economic background for the appointment.
Appointment aims to avoid budget crisis and fix asylum system against Reform UK.
